SUMMARY
The selected state of which room you are viewing is not reset when switching
between tablet to mouse, resulting in two rooms appearing "open".
This is only reset with restarting NeoChat

STEPS TO REPRODUCE
1. Have a digital tablet plugged in
2. Using the tablet pen, click on a room to view it
3. Using a mouse, click on a different room

OBSERVED RESULT
Two rooms have the selected state

EXPECTED RESULT
Only the current room you are viewing shows as selected
